Understand How a RAV4 Lease Works 💳

Leasing is different from financing because you’re paying for the vehicle’s depreciation, plus interest and fees, over a set period.

The Leasing Process Step by Step 📋

  1. Select your preferred trim: LE, XLE, Adventure, Hybrid, or Prime.
  2. Submit an application: Lenders review your credit score, debt-to-income ratio, and income proof.
  3. Negotiate terms: Mileage limits, upfront costs, and monthly payments are agreed upon.
  4. Enjoy your RAV4: Drive the vehicle for the lease duration, typically 24–36 months.
  5. End-of-lease options: Return the car, purchase it at residual value, or upgrade to a newer lease.

Requirements for a Toyota RAV4 Lease in 2025 ✅

To qualify for the most competitive lease offers, you generally need:

  • Credit score of 670+ for lower APR and monthly payments.
  • Stable income verification such as pay stubs or tax returns.
  • Down payment or trade-in to reduce lease costs.
  • Mileage agreement: Typically 12,000–15,000 miles per year.
  • Insurance coverage: Full coverage insurance is mandatory on leased vehicles.

Weight Pros and Cons of a Lease ⚖️

Pros:

  • Affordable access to new models.
  • Warranty coverage reduces maintenance costs.
  • Advanced trims like Hybrid and Prime are easier to afford.
  • Flexibility to adapt when your lifestyle changes.

Cons:

  • Mileage limits can be restrictive for long-distance drivers.
  • Possible wear-and-tear fees at lease return.
  • No ownership equity unless you buy at the end.
  • Higher insurance premiums are often required.

See the RAV4 Lease Trims Explained 🚙

Toyota RAV4 LE 🛣️

The LE is the base trim, starting around $30,000. Equipped with a 2.5L 4-cylinder engine delivering 203 horsepower, Toyota Safety Sense 2.5, LED headlights, and Apple CarPlay/Android Auto, it provides excellent value. 

Leasing keeps monthly payments near $320–$350, ideal for families who need practicality at a low cost.

Toyota RAV4 XLE Premium ⚡

The XLE Premium trim adds SofTex-trimmed seats, dual-zone climate control, and a power moonroof, creating a more upscale experience. 

Leasing this trim averages $360–$390 per month, letting drivers enjoy comfort features without committing to full ownership.

Toyota RAV4 Hybrid XSE 🌱

The Hybrid XSE combines 219 horsepower with up to 41 mpg city fuel economy. Eco-conscious drivers appreciate its efficiency, while leasing makes this trim more accessible with payments of $400–$430. 

The lower fuel costs offset part of the lease expense, making it budget-friendly long-term.

Toyota RAV4 Adventure 🌄

The Adventure trim is built for outdoor lifestyles. With dynamic torque vectoring AWD, rugged design elements, and enhanced towing capacity, it handles city commutes and weekend getaways with ease. 

Lease offers generally range $410–$440 monthly, appealing to adventurers who want capability without high ownership costs.

Toyota RAV4 Prime 🔋

The RAV4 Prime is the high-performance plug-in hybrid, producing 302 horsepower with up to 42 miles of electric-only range

With a retail price above $43,000, leasing is the most affordable way to experience its speed and efficiency. Payments typically range from $480–$520 depending on credit and incentives.

Tips for Securing the Best Toyota RAV4 Lease 🏁

  • Compare multiple dealerships for regional and promotional differences.
  • Time your lease around seasonal manufacturer incentives.
  • Negotiate mileage allowances to fit your lifestyle.
  • Consider add-ons carefully to avoid inflating costs.
  • Get pre-approved through a credit union or bank to negotiate confidently.

FAQ ❓

  1. What credit score is needed for a Toyota RAV4 lease?
  • Most lenders look for 670+, but some accept fair credit with adjusted terms.
  1. Can I lease hybrid and Prime RAV4 versions?
  • Yes, leasing options cover gas, hybrid, and plug-in hybrid trims.
  1. What happens if I go over my lease mileage limit?
  • Extra mileage fees apply, typically charged per mile over the agreement.
  1. Can I buy my RAV4 at the end of the lease?
  • Yes, you can purchase it at the residual value specified in your lease.
  1. What’s the biggest benefit of leasing a Toyota RAV4?
  • Lower monthly payments and frequent upgrades to new models without long-term ownership risks.
